Transaction

d6ecd52c56728e3756a90804eafedde65b0994211b050384dc363c4dabc384ed

Summary

In Block886205
TimeThu, 26 Sep 2024 05:21:45 UTC
Total Input2242.03305872 Nebula
Total Output2242.03299512 Nebula
Fees0.0000636 Nebula

Details

Fee: 0.0000636 Nebula
71122 Confirmations2242.03299512 Nebula
Raw Transaction